About this project

What does The other mans game add?

This mod adds a new dimension 2 new mobs new biomes new ores and block and recipes and weapons theirs a lot to this mod i recommend using JEI as the recipes can get confusing and the mobs spawn eggs are in miscellaneous as for some reason they wont stay in the new creative tab.This mod will be updated and items and more will also be added often for the foreseeable future.with the newest update of the mod there is a new structure the abandoned shack a small home were a previous player may of lived there and theirs a blood dungeon and a new mob called the blood bug also a grape bush which you can get grapes from duh and make wine... And once again ive just updated the mod this update adds a wizards tower which has a new mob for u to fight but it may remind you of something and also theirs a bunch of other new mobs the blood Golem and the Blood skeleton which doesn't use a bow and theirs the unholy creeper and now a new record for u to Craft !!

And now with the newest update ive added a bunch of new mods to fill out the world like just small critters that may be useful for upcoming recipes like small turtles and a common lizard and sand lizards theirs elephants and once killed they will be come a carcass which u can harvest theirs also the blood witch which drops its hat on death then you can harvest the hat to get the hand held item and there is also a ghost creeper which drops exoplasm which can also be crafted with spectral powder other mobs include blood cow carcass and a vampire which can make vampire elixir with its teeth and many more mobs which includes one of my favorite mobs the unholy skeleton which on deaths becomes a bone pile were u can get spectral bones all the carcasses and bone piles do not have spawn eggs and are only dropped/spawned when the mob it comes from dies.
